{ "document_metadata": { "page_number": "225", "document_number": "767", "date": "08/10/22", "document_type": "Court Document", "has_handwriting": false, "has_stamps": false }, "full_text": "Case 1:20-cr-00330-PAE Document 767 Filed 08/10/22 Page 225 of 257 3059 LCKCmax9 Charge\n\n1 In addition, you need not be unanimous as to which overt act you find to have been committed. It is sufficient as long as all of you find that at least one overt act was committed by one of the conspirators.\n\n2 As to Counts One and Three, the government has to prove that at least one of the overt acts in furtherance of that conspiracy involved a witness other than Kate. Put simply, you may not convict Ms. Maxwell on Counts One or Three solely on the basis of Kate's testimony or an overt act involving Kate.\n\n3 You are further instructed that the overt act need not have been committed at precisely at the time alleged in the indictment. It is sufficient if you are convinced beyond a reasonable doubt that it occurred at or about the time and place stated.\n\n4 Instruction No. 37: Counts One, Three, and Five: Conspiracy to Violate Federal Law - Fourth Element.\n\n5 The fourth and final element which the government must prove beyond a reasonable doubt is that the overt act was committed for the purpose of carrying out the unlawful agreement.\n\n6 In order for the government to satisfy this element, it must prove beyond a reasonable doubt that at least one overt act was knowingly and willfully done by at least one coconspirator in furtherance of some object or purpose of the\n\nSOUTHERN DISTRICT REPORTERS, P.C.
